Resumo
This paper presents two areas located in the western region of the state of Bahia, with the occurrence of black limestone featuring recrystallized white calcite. These two areas cover approximately 6,000 km2 and is located near good road infrastructure, situated within 90 km of the alignment of the West-East Integration Railway. The rock, which holds potential for ornamental use, is associated with the Lagoa do Jacaré Formation, predominantly composed of calcirudites and calcarenites, as well as the Sete Lagoas Formation, consisting of shales, mudstones, and limestones. Both formations exhibit the potential for the occurrence of black limestone with white (translucent) sections, linked to the presence of white calcite and occasionally fluorite.
